2019 Haptic Technology Seminar and Preparatory Meeting of AsiaHaptics 2020 Held at Beihang
Release time:April 30, 2019 / Li Siying

Hosted by the National Engineering Laboratory of Virtual Reality and Augmented Reality (NELVRAR) of Beihang University, the 2019 Haptic Technology Seminar and Preparatory Meeting of AsiaHaptics 2020 was held at the International Convention Center of New Main Building on April 20, 2019.

A number of famous experts from universities and institutes, who are engaged in haptic interaction, were invited to attend the meeting. They discussed about the cutting-edge technologies in the field concerned, as well as preparatory work plans of AsiaHaptics 2020.

Supported by the IEEE Technical Committee on Haptics, the 4th Asia Haptics 2020 will be held in Beijing, China. It is co-hosted by Beihang University, IEEE Technical Committee on Hapticsand China Society of Image and Graphics; undertaken by NELVRAR and the School of Mechanical Engineering & Automation of Beihang University; co-organized by the Human Computer Interaction Committee of China Computer Federation and the Virtual Reality and Visualization Technology Committee.

Dr. Liu Guanyang from the NELVRAR chaired the meeting, which began with a welcome address from Professor Li Deyu, director of Global Beihang. Professor Li spoke highly of the event which is of positive significance to enhance international communication and talent cultivation of Beihang University.

Professor Hu Shimin, director of NELVRAR, delivered a speech to introduce the significant changes that the technology of virtual reality is making in people’s life, as well as the role that haptic interaction plays in promoting the immersion of virtual reality.

Professor Wang Dangxiao, General Chair of AsiaHaptics 2020, introduced the history of development and the goal of the meeting. Associate Professor Liu Qian from Dalian University of Technology, Associate Professor from Xiamen University, and Guo Zeyong from Beihang University introduced in detail the budget, website construction and the logo design about the preparation for AsiaHaptics 2020.

The second part of the haptic technology seminar was hosted by Professor Sun Xiaoying, Dean of College of Communication Engineering of Jilin University. Three talks were given in this part by Professor Xu Weiliang from the University of Auckland in New Zealand, Professor Xu Yingqing from Tsinghua University, and Professor Song Aiguo from Southeast University respectively. They introduced the deformable multimodal haptic sensor array of soft-bodied robots, the research on haptic cognition and interactive experience design for the blind people, and the force sense measurement and the ergonomic evaluation of dexterous manipulation of space station.

At the end of the meeting, Editor Qi Yuan introduced the Virtual Reality & Intelligent Hardware (VRIH), a journal sponsored by Beihang University. She invited more scholars to contribute their works to VRIH. The Chinese Academy of Sciences is in charge of the journal.

AsiaHaptics is a new type of international conference for the haptics fields, featuring interactive presentations with demos. It is held biannually to alternate the World Haptics Conference, each attracting 200 to 300 attendees related to haptic hardware, human haptic perception, and other haptic applications around the world.
